According to census.gov, 14.6% of the total population of North Dakota is age 65 and older.

Q: What percent of the population of North Dakota is age 65 and older?

How much older is North Dakota than South Dakota?

They are both the same age; both being made states on November 2, 1889. North Dakota is before South Dakota in the list of states created only because of alphabetical order.
